///|
pub let canopen_nmt_cob_id : Int = 0x000
///|
pub let canopen_tpdo1_base_cob_id : Int = 0x180
///|
pub let canopen_rpdo1_base_cob_id : Int = 0x200
///|
pub let canopen_sdo_upload_base_cob_id : Int = 0x580
///|
pub let canopen_sdo_download_base_cob_id : Int = 0x600
///|
pub let canopen_heartbeat_base_cob_id : Int = 0x700
///|
pub fn canopen_tpdo1_cob_id(node_id~ : Int) -> Int {
canopen_tpdo1_base_cob_id + node_id
}
///|
pub fn canopen_rpdo1_cob_id(node_id~ : Int) -> Int {
canopen_rpdo1_base_cob_id + node_id
}
///|
pub fn canopen_sdo_upload_cob_id(node_id~ : Int) -> Int {
canopen_sdo_upload_base_cob_id + node_id
}
///|
pub fn canopen_sdo_download_cob_id(node_id~ : Int) -> Int {
canopen_sdo_download_base_cob_id + node_id
}
///|
pub fn canopen_heartbeat_cob_id(node_id~ : Int) -> Int {
canopen_heartbeat_base_cob_id + node_id
}
///|
pub(all) enum CanopenNmtCommand {
EnterOperational
EnterStopped
EnterPreOperational
ResetNode
ResetCommunication
} derive(Eq, Debug)
///|
pub fn CanopenNmtCommand::code(self : CanopenNmtCommand) -> Int {
match self {
EnterOperational => 1
EnterStopped => 2
EnterPreOperational => 128
ResetNode => 129
ResetCommunication => 130
}
}
///|
pub fn CanopenNmtCommand::label(self : CanopenNmtCommand) -> String {
match self {
EnterOperational => "enter_operational"
EnterStopped => "enter_stopped"
EnterPreOperational => "enter_pre_operational"
ResetNode => "reset_node"
ResetCommunication => "reset_communication"
}
}
///|
pub(all) enum CanopenNmtState {
Bootup
PreOperational
Operational
Stopped
} derive(Eq, Debug)
///|
pub fn CanopenNmtState::code(self : CanopenNmtState) -> Int {
match self {
Bootup => 0
PreOperational => 127
Operational => 5
Stopped => 4
}
}
///|
pub fn CanopenNmtState::label(self : CanopenNmtState) -> String {
match self {
Bootup => "bootup"
PreOperational => "pre_operational"
Operational => "operational"
Stopped => "stopped"
}
}
